Hyderabad: The BJP leaders on Thursday met Governor E.S.L. Narasimhan at Raj Bhavan in the wake of dissolution of Legislative Assembly. BJP MP Bandaru Dattatreya, MLAs G. Kishan Reddy, C. Ramachandra Reddy were  among those who met the governor. They urged the governor to ensure that the caretaker state government led by TRS does not misuse power for political gains in elections.

They brought to the notice of governor that the TRS government had grossly misused power in organising the public meeting at Kongara Kalan on city outskirts recently. They complained that all buses in state including that of private educational institutions and TSRTC were pressed into service for transporting people from districts for the meeting by grossly misusing the power.

Mr Kishan Reddy said the Central government should control the caretaker government during elections as there is a danger of TRS leaders trying to misuse revenue, police departments for their political gains.
